A Celebration of Life for Sherrill Virginia Odum (Farlander), will be held on Saturday, April 7, noon, at Lone Pine VFW Post 8036. Sherrill crossed over peacefully, surrounded by the love of family and friends, in Reno, NV on March 8, 2018.

Born Sherrill Virginia Odum on July 27, 1951 in La Puente, Sherrill moved to Lone Pine as a young girl along with her mother, Patricia Farlander, and four siblings. Over the years, Sherrill has lived in San Marcos, Redding, Isla Vista, Bullhead City, AZ, and Ridgecrest, finally returning to the Owens Valley in 2009 when she moved to Big Pine and later to Bishop, to live with her daughter, where she has resided since.
